`Where` Address Components
An Address is comprised of 3 key elements:
- Unique name
- Unique number
- Unique entry point
To explain these three concepts, consider the following address (This is a non-existent sample address):
- Name: 15 Taifa Road, Pangani, Nairobi County
- Number: 247626701615
- Geo-coordinates: – 1.298547, 36.85478
Unique Name
The address above is ‘15 Taifa Road, Pangani, Nairobi County’. This can be broken down into the following:
- Sequential ordering number: 15
- Road name: Taifa Road
- Region name: Pangani
- County name: Nairobi County
Unique Number
The sample address above has an address number: 247626701615. This can be broken down into the following:
- Sequential ordering number: 15
- Road name: 2476267016
- Region name: 247626
- County name: 247
Unique Entry Point
The sample address above has these geo-coordinates: – 1.298547, 36.85478.
- Latitude: – 1.298547
- Longitude: 36.85478
